This project aims to design, develop and test a web-based toolkit that will enhance the capacity of Canadians living with chronic diseases and their caregivers, to find services and resources that could meet their needs.
People living with chronic diseases and their caregivers often feel lost and confused when attempting to navigate our health care system. Not knowing where to turn to for help, they often end up relying on busy hospital emergency rooms for non-urgent problems, with unsatisfactory results. Social workers, nurses and other professionals trained to guide people to services that could meet their needs are insufficient to meet demand. Meanwhile, relevant community-based information and referral services are underutilized. Hence, this projects aims to develop the Health eConcierge, a web-based toolkit that will enhance the capacity of Canadians living with chronic diseases and their caregivers, to find services and resources that could meet their needs.
